Hair straightener
Hair straightener was recalled on 16 September 2011 under EU Safety Gate alert 0929/11. Electric shock risk reported by Spain. The insulation of the mains cable is not sufficiently heat resistant.

Risk Description
The insulation of the mains cable is not sufficiently heat resistant. Live parts are left accessible when the insulation of the mains cable melts on contact with the hot parts of the appliance.The product does not comply with the Low Voltage Directive (LVD) and the relevant European standard EN 60335.
Product Description
Silver and white-coloured hair straightener. The product is sold in a blister pack.
